BREAKING NEWS – ACM Nominees Announced

This morning (4-13) The Academy of Country Music announced nominations for the 58th ACM Awards.
HARDY leads with seven nominations including Song of the Year and Artist-Songwriter of the Year. He shares three of his nominations with Lainey Wilson for their song “Wait in the Truck”.
Lainey received the most nods for a female artist with six, including Female Artist of the Year. She is nominated in more categories than any other artist.
Luke Combs, Kane Brown, and Cole Swindell follow HARDY with the second-most nominations for a male artist, with five total nods each. Luke Combs and Chris Stapleton are nominees for Entertainer of the Year. A win for either artist in this category will also clinch the coveted Triple Crown Award, which consists of Entertainer.
This is the fourth year in a row that Luke Combs is nominated for both Male Artist and Entertainer of the Year. Kane Brown received his first ever nominations for Entertainer of the Year and Male Artist of the Year.
The most-awarded artist in ACM history, Miranda Lambert, received her record-breaking 17th Female Artist of the Year nomination (passing Reba McEntire with 16), as well as four other nominations.
Of note: At least one woman is nominated in Every Eligible Main Awards Category this year.
Hosted by Dolly Parton and Garth Brooks, the show will stream from Frisco, Texas on Prime Video on May 11.
